A Friendly Letter to Skeptics and Atheists helpsreaders--both secular and religious--appreciate theircommon ground. For those whose thinking has moved from thereligious thesis to the skeptical antithesis (or vice versa), Myersoffers pointers to a science-respecting Christian synthesis. Heshows how skeptics and people of faith can share a commitment toreason, evidence, and critical thinking, while also embracing afaith that supports human flourishing--by making sense of theuniverse, giving meaning to life, connecting us in supportivecommunities, mandating altruism, and offering hope in the face ofadversity and death.
